Celtic boss Neil Lennon is thought to be wanting to add a new centre-back to his ranks at Parkhead this summer.

Celtic fans have suggested that they want Erik Sviatchenko back, amid rumours he is available for £2 million.
Aksam have reported that the former Celtic man could be set to move to Trabzonspor this summer.
But Celtic fans have urged Neil Lennon to make a move to hijack any potential deal for the centre-back and bring him back to Parkhead.
Celtic are on the look out for a new centre-back this summer, following the departures of Dedryck Boyata and Filip Benkonvic.
Celtic need a player to accompany Kristoffer Ajer in the heart of their defence, and Sviatchenko could present a good option.
During this first spell with Celtic, Sviatchenko made 63 appearances for the Bhoys, before leaving to join FC Midtjylland in 2018.
Celtic have struggled to make additions so far this summer, and are still on the hunt for new signings, as Lennon looks to strengthen his squad for next term.
